The Weber State Wildcats men's basketball statistical leaders are individual statistical leaders of the Weber State Wildcats men's basketball program in various categories,[1] including points, assists, blocks, rebounds, and steals. Within those areas, the lists identify single-game, single-season, and career leaders. The Wildcats represent Weber State University in the NCAA's Big Sky Conference.
Weber State began competing in intercollegiate basketball in 1962.[1] The NCAA did not officially record assists as a stat until the 1983–84 season, and blocks and steals until the 1985–86 season, but Weber State's record books includes players in these stats before these seasons. These lists are updated through the end of the 2020–21 season.
